trip of our life by SheilaP2

Sail date: / Traveled as: Couple
Ship: Costa Atlantica / Destination: Canada, New England, New York

My husband and I recently went on the Atlantica for their eastern seaboard cruise. We have travelled extensively for years [all-inclusives] independant, and cruises] and we both agreed that this was one of our best trips ever. We loved the ports of call and got to see places that we had only dreamed of seeing. The staff for the most part were very friendly and professional. We were very impressed with the cleanliness of the ship, especially in this time of flu season. It made us feel relaxed about coming down with some bug or other. The cabins were quite roomy even our inside cabin. We liked the fact that they had happy hour every day, but felt that 11:00 AM was way too early for the first one! When you are heading off for land tours, you really don't need to have a drink first!!! There were some negative things too. For instance, all the Canadian and Americans heartily disliked being charged in Euros in their own countries! I doubt if they are charged Canadian or American in Europe!! It almost felt like an insult. The front desk people were not the best for sure at handling problems. In fact, we had a problem and they just upset us further. Not a good impression on our first cruise with Costa. In fact, we wrote about not receiving our ship board credit, and they haven't bothered to answer us. Not too impressed there! They catered too much to the European clientele with the entertainment. eg. the music for dancing, and the lounge music. The North Americans definitely felt like outsiders at times. [We talked to many people about this] Would we go with Costa again. Yes, because we felt that it was good value for our money and it had enough positive things about it. if you are young, I would hesitate to go on the trip we took because it was geared towards a much older crowd. Sometimes we felt too young and we are 61 and 64!!!!

Costa Atlantica by Steve3

Sail date: / Traveled as: Family (young children)
Ship: Costa Atlantica / Destination: Caribbean - Western

It was a very clean ship - people constantly were washing the deck / windows / etc. The restaurant, however, was very disorganized. Service there was substandard, although the food was acceptable. Breakfast and lunch had particularly poor restaurant service - slow, large numbers of mistakes, difficulty getting coffee or utensils. Dinner service was slow and confused -- courses were rarely served to the whole table at the same time. The buffet was pretty good with fewer service issues, although we saw several other guests treated rudely by some of the staff. The cabin service was excellent. The room was kept very clean, and the staff was very professional.
